If you want to level up your web development skills and make your projects more efficient, there's a handy trick that can simplify your workflow: mastering the power of JavaScript. Whether you're a seasoned developer or a newcomer to coding, understanding how to use JavaScript effectively can take your projects to the next level.
JavaScript is a versatile programming language that plays a crucial role in building dynamic and interactive web pages. By incorporating JavaScript into your projects, you can create responsive and user-friendly features that enhance the overall user experience. One of the key benefits of using JavaScript is its ability to manipulate the HTML and CSS of a webpage, allowing you to dynamically update content and interact with users in real time.
To make the most of JavaScript in your web projects, it's essential to understand some key concepts and best practices. One powerful technique that can simplify your development process is using JavaScript libraries and frameworks. These pre-written sets of code provide reusable functions and components that can significantly speed up the development process and reduce the amount of code you need to write from scratch.
Popular JavaScript libraries like jQuery, React, and Vue.js offer a wide range of functionalities that can streamline your development workflow. Whether you need to create interactive animations, handle user input, or fetch data from external sources, these libraries provide ready-made solutions that can save you time and effort. By leveraging these libraries in your projects, you can focus on building out the core functionalities of your application without getting bogged down in repetitive tasks.
Another tip to simplify your web projects with JavaScript is to optimize your code for performance. This includes minimizing the use of global variables, optimizing loops, and avoiding unnecessary DOM manipulations. By writing clean and efficient code, you can ensure that your web pages load quickly and operate smoothly across different platforms and devices.
Moreover, organizing your JavaScript code into modular components can make your projects more maintainable and scalable. By breaking down your code into smaller, reusable modules, you can easily debug issues, update features, and collaborate with other developers. Tools like Webpack and Babel can help you manage your JavaScript modules effectively and ensure that your codebase remains clean and organized.
In addition to using libraries and optimizing your code, incorporating modern JavaScript features like arrow functions, template literals, and destructuring can make your code more readable and concise. These features not only improve the overall syntax of your code but also enhance its performance and maintainability.
Overall, mastering the art of JavaScript can unlock a world of possibilities for your web projects. By leveraging libraries, optimizing your code, and embracing modern JavaScript features, you can simplify your development process and create powerful and engaging web applications. So why not give it a try and see how JavaScript can take your projects to the next level?